Portable power stations are getting bigger, heavier and more complicated but the BLUETTI Elite 300 is trying to flip that script. Packing a hefty 3,014Wh capacity into a unit that’s only around 26.3kg, it delivers more usable power without turning your setup into a deadlift session. Whether you’re at the track, camping off-grid, or just keeping the fridge cold while you’re out trail riding, this thing is built to keep everything humming.

With 2,400W of output (4,800W surge), the Elite 300 can handle everything from laptops and cameras to fridges, lights and power tools. It can even charge most electric bikes! You get a solid spread of ports too, AC outlets, USB-A, high-speed USB-C, 12V DC and a cigarette lighter port, so it’ll run just about anything you’d normally plug into the wall or your ute. Charging is flexible as well, with options for AC (up to 2,300W), solar (up to 1,200W), or a combo of both, meaning less time waiting around and more time using it.

Inside, it runs a LiFePO₄ battery rated for up to 6,000 cycles, which is a fancy way of saying it’s built to last. There’s also a ≤10ms UPS switchover, so if the power cuts out at home, your gear barely notices. Add in app control via Bluetooth and Wi-Fi, and you can monitor or control it straight from your phone.

Key Specs
Capacity: 3,014Wh
Output: 2,400W (4,800W surge)
Battery: LiFePO₄ (up to 6,000 cycles)
Weight: 26.3kg
Charging: AC (2,300W), Solar (1,200W), AC + Solar (2,400W)
UPS: ≤10ms switchover
Ports: AC, USB-A, USB-C, 12V DC, Cigarette
